Aniket Kulkarni is a scholar working on Reproductive Medicine, Pediatrics, Perinatology and Child Health and General Health Professions. According to data from OpenAlex, Aniket Kulkarni has authored 31 papers receiving a total of 1.3k ind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 15 papers in Reproductive Medicine, 14 papers in Pediatrics, Perinatology and Child Health and 7 papers in General Health Professions. Recurrent topics in Aniket Kulkarni's work include Assisted Reproductive Technology and Twin Pregnancy (13 papers), Reproductive Health and Technologies (9 papers) and Ovarian function and disorders (6 papers). Aniket Kulkarni is often cited by papers focused on Assisted Reproductive Technology and Twin Pregnancy (13 papers), Reproductive Health and Technologies (9 papers) and Ovarian function and disorders (6 papers). Aniket Kulkarni collaborates with scholars based in United States and Rwanda. Aniket Kulkarni's co-authors include Denise J. Jamieson, Dmitry M. Kissin, Trisha Mueller, Lorrie Gavin, Maurizio Macaluso, Jennifer F. Kawwass, Sara Crawford, Shanna Cox, Eli Y. Adashi and Maria F Gallo and has published in prestigious journals such as New England Journal of Medicine, JAMA and American Journal of Epidemiology.
